Zuckerberg says Meta bought Instagram for superior camera technology

Meta CEO Mark Zuckerberg made a key concession at a U.S. antitrust trial on Tuesday, saying he purchased Instagram as a result of it had a “better” digital camera than the one his firm was making an attempt to construct beneath its flagship Facebook model on the time.

The acknowledgement appeared to bolster allegations by U.S. antitrust enforcers that Meta had used a “buy or bury” technique to snap up potential rivals, preserve smaller opponents at bay and keep an unlawful monopoly.

It got here throughout Zuckerberg’s second day testifying on the high-stakes trial in Washington, during which the U.S. Federal Trade Commission is looking for to unwind Meta’s acquisitions of prized property Instagram and WhatsApp.

The case, filed throughout President Donald Trump’s first time period, is broadly seen as a check of the brand new Trump administration’s guarantees to tackle Big Tech firms.

Asked by an legal professional for the FTC whether or not he thought fast-growing Instagram might be damaging to Meta, then often known as Facebook, Zuckerberg stated he believed Instagram had a greater digital camera than what his firm was constructing.

“We were doing a build vs. buy analysis” whereas within the technique of constructing a digital camera app, Zuckerberg stated. “I thought that Instagram was better at that, so I thought it was better to buy them.”

The firm argues that his previous intentions are irrelevant as a result of the FTC has outlined the social media market inaccurately and didn’t account for stiff competitors Meta has confronted from ByteDance’s TikTok, Alphabet’s YouTube and Apple’s messaging app.

“BUILDING A NEW APP IS HARD”

Zuckerberg additionally acknowledged that lots of the firm’s makes an attempt at constructing its personal apps had failed.

“Building a new app is hard and many more times than not when we have tried to build a new app it hasn’t gotten a lot of traction,” Zuckerberg advised the courtroom.

“We probably tried building dozens of apps over the history of the company and the majority of them don’t go anywhere,” he stated.

Zuckerberg’s testimony comes as Meta is defending itself years after the discharge of damning statements plucked from Facebook’s personal paperwork, like a 2008 e-mail during which he stated “it is better to buy than compete.”

The FTC accuses Meta of holding a monopoly on platforms used to share content material with family and friends, the place its important opponents within the United States are Snap’s Snapchat and MeWe, a tiny privacy-focused social media app launched in 2016.

Platforms the place customers broadcast content material to strangers primarily based on shared pursuits, akin to X, TikTok, YouTube and Reddit , usually are not interchangeable, the FTC argues.

INCREASED ADS

Zuckerberg additionally disputed the FTC’s declare that Meta is ready to present customers extra advertisements as a result of it lacks opponents, one other key pillar of the case.

While antitrust lawsuits usually look to a monopolist’s means at a monopolist’s means to lift costs on prospects, the FTC has pointed to Meta’s means to decrease the standard of apps that customers entry at no cost, akin to by rising the variety of advertisements.

Zuckerberg pushed again on the concept that extra advertisements equals a worse person expertise, saying advertisements on Meta’s apps have improved and its system is designed to “show more ad content to people who like seeing ad content.”

Meta has even contemplated introducing a feed that was all advertisements, Zuckerberg instructed beneath questioning by FTC legal professional Daniel Matheson.

“I think we have discussed it at different points but I don’t think we have done it,” Zuckerberg stated.
